    Nothing would need to be "nerfed" the information we are given just needs to change. For instance, Embrace currently says 150, but relevant to our stats it should say like 100. The player just needs to know the potency based on their own stats.

    Quote Originally Posted by SomeRandomHuman View Post
    they are displayed under the actions tab at the very bottom. For example: fairy embrace is 150 potency.

    For SMN the egi-assault action tell you the relevant pet action that will be performed by each egi and, like sch, all their potencies and skills are displayed at the bottom of the actions tab.
    Garuda's auto-attack is a 30 potency aoe
    Titan's is a 60 potency single target
    Ifrit's is 80 potency single target.
    Those are the potencies based on the pet's stats, not the players. The potencies need to be adjusted to reflect the what they are based on our stats.

    For instance the potencies you listed are better expressed as; Faerie:100, Garuda:20, Titan:45, Ifrit:60. Those are a more accurate potencies based on the players stats.
